First, consider tech gadgets. Teens are drawn to them like moths to a flame. Are they music enthusiasts? Portable Bluetooth speakers could be a hit, with more shapes and colors available than you can count. Aspiring photographers might appreciate an affordable instant camera to snap those spontaneous moments—or merely their breakfast art. And let’s not forget their limitless appetite for smartphone accessories, from quirky cases to sleek wireless earbuds.
If your teen retains a bit of childhood wonder, action-packed board games could do the trick. Think beyond the classics; imagine a hybrid of dodgeball and strategy, minus the bruises. This can double as family bonding time, though beware—they might just outplay you.
Onward to the digital realm. Gaming is where many teens truly shine. Whether it’s a console upgrade or the newest game craze, you’ll be a hero when you hand over that controller. And it’s not just about chasing zombies—many games foster management skills, creativity, and historical knowledge. Plus, they serve as excellent motivational tools—”Complete your homework, then you can conquer medieval England.”
But what if screens aren’t their preferred medium? Some 13-year-olds might prefer scientist kits or intricate model sets, fueling the next generation of creative minds. Not every stellar gift is bound to technology or the online sphere.
There’s also immense value in clothing and accessories that reflect a teen’s personality. Beyond mere utility or comfort, these items speak to their sense of style and self-expression. Hoodies with bold statements or thematic necklaces and bracelets can make them feel like they’re on top of the world. And don’t overlook the power of gift cards to favorite shops; they appreciate the autonomy to make their own choices.
For those with creative souls, consider a subscription box packed with art supplies or journaling essentials. Ideal for the young Picasso or aspiring author, it might even inspire them to share a doodle of gratitude—or simply a heartfelt text.
Let’s also talk about gifting experiences. Think concert tickets, a day at a theme park, or a culinary class for future chefs. These experiences can create lasting memories stronger than any photo album.
